Formatação de código do desenvolvedor SQL

9

Acabei de recortar e colar algum código SQL no desenvolvedor do SQL (4.0.2.15). Eu tenho uma margem direita definida e selecionei CTRL + F7 para formatá-lo. No entanto, eu tenho dois problemas

  1. O código é mais amplo que a margem certa que defini
  2. As palavras-chave estão em maiúsculas e o padrão de codificação aqui é minúsculo.

Não consegui descobrir como alterar isso ou isso é possível?

Ed Heal
fonte

Respostas:

7

Eu fiz uma pesquisa no google pela frase "formatação de código do desenvolvedor sql", e o primeiro resultado foi:

http://www.thatjeffsmith.com/archive/2014/03/how-to-make-your-code-look-like-steven-feuersteins-in-oracle-sql-developer/

Leia a publicação de Jeff Smith, gerente de produto do SQL Developer. Isso deve explicar o que você precisa fazer.

Editado para adicionar uma imagem das opções relevantes.
foto da árvore mostrando as opções relevantes

Phil Sumner
fonte
Eu li essa página. As opções para mim são importar / exportar as configurações como um arquivo XML - não a caixa de diálogo conforme exibida. Eu devo estar usando uma versão mais antiga.
Ed Heal #
@ EdHeal: parece que você não está no "ramo" certo no menu de preferências. As opções de importação / exportação estão no nó "Database / SQL Formatter", você precisa ir mais longe em "Database / SQL Formatter / Oracle Formatting" e clicar em "editar" ao lado do menu suspenso de perfil nessa tela. Isso funciona no 4.0.2.
Mat
3

Na verdade, foi movido na v17.4

Pode ser encontrado em: Oracle SQL Developer -> Preferências ... -> Editor de Código -> Formato

e Opcionalmente -> Formato avançado -> Formato personalizado

Thronk
fonte